Course content overview:
•    Strategic reward frameworks – Designing incentive structures that align with long-term business goals and encourage innovation
•    Effective innovation programmes – How to implement systems that capture employee ideas and translate them into actionable business improvements
•    The role of recognition in driving innovation – How companies like 3M and British Airways have leveraged recognition to boost creativity and performance
•    Financial vs. non-financial incentives – Balancing monetary rewards with career growth, professional development, and public recognition
•    Skill-based pay in practice – Understanding how pay-for-skills models improve workforce flexibility, productivity, and quality
•    Overcoming barriers to innovation – Addressing leadership resistance, disengagement, and quality control in employee-driven initiatives
•    Measuring success – Implementing the right metrics to track engagement, innovation impact, and return on investment
